Countrywide protests against tax rises and a cost-of-living crisis are met by a police crackdown in Kenya on Wednesday. At least 13 people are believed to have died in a day of violence.

It's also playtime for these children who've fled racist violence in the Tunisian city of Sfax to the militarised buffer zone bordering Libya. Tunisia's president has been accused of stoking tensions leading to widespread attacks on sub-Saharan migrants in the country.
